Transaction 2726203008e7fbe6aaade56d2602f8d1a344cd41044132330749fcf99fd27700
1 Input
1 Output
-
2726203008e7fbe6aaade56d2602f8d1a344cd41044132330749fcf99fd27700:0
- value
- 95579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 615169246f515fd10f2d9ffd48f1c44013c5aba5 OP_EQUAL
- address
- 3AZazfdDJ6eWusTZRzK433mwoSY7Mkw78A